2 key ingredients that make or break the perfect Caldo de Res
When preparing Caldo de Res, undoubtedly the star of the dish is the beef. Bone-in beef shank (also known as beef soup bones) is used for its rich, deep flavor and tends to be the favored choice amongst Mexican home cooks and chefs alike. The marrow from the beef bones intensifies the taste, making for a more hearty and flavorsome broth.
Vegetables in Caldo de Res are not of less important, rather they play a complementary role, adding an earthy flavor and healthy nutritional value to the soup. The commonly used vegetables in this dish are carrots, potatoes, cabbage, and corn. While each one adds its unique flavor to the dish, together they create the perfect harmony of texture and taste, making Caldo de Res a wholesome and nourishing meal option.
The making of Caldo de Res
Like many other famous dishes, Caldo de Res is made in various ways following individual preferences and family traditions. Yet, the essence of the recipe lies in the subtle balance of textures and flavors. A hearty mix of bone-in beef shank, corn, carrots, cabbage, and potatoes boiled in a large pot of spices and herbs make up this soup.
While it stands as a complete meal on its own, Caldo de Res can be served with tortillas or a splash of lime, enhancing the experience even more, while complementing the robust flavor of the soup.
